Rare Earths Controls Remain Unresolved in US-China Deal

A recent trade agreement between the US and China has been criticized for not fully addressing controls on rare earth exports. According to Reuters, a report from the news agency cites two individuals familiar with the matter, stating that restrictions tied to national security were left unresolved in the agreement. This oversight has implications for global supply lines, highlighting the need for further clarification and regulation in the industry.
